What is Cle 075?

Cle 075 is a certification course that provides a basic understanding of cloud computing and its impact on the DoD. The course covers topics such as the benefits and limitations of cloud computing, cloud deployment models, security, and risk management. DoD contractors and personnel looking to migrate their workloads to the cloud or work with cloud service providers can greatly benefit from the course.

Real-World Examples

One of the most popular cloud computing services used by the DoD is Amazon Web Services (AWS). AWS has been used for various DoD projects, including the Defense Logistics Agency’s (DLA) migration of more than 200 applications and systems to the cloud. The DLA’s move to the cloud resulted in $19 million in savings, increased efficiency, and enhanced cybersecurity.

Another example of cloud computing in the DoD is the Defense Information Systems Agency’s (DISA) milCloud® 2.0. MilCloud 2.0 is a DoD-owned and operated cloud that provides a secure environment for the deployment of DoD-specific applications. The milCloud 2.0 service is available to all DoD personnel and contractors.
